No. Although if you have VPN access to your house you can use the web page (and filters) that way. I don't think the app will help either, whenever it is finally released, as it will be focused around presence and dashboard use.

Dashboard has a history option for any device, either select the 3 dot menu for the tile assigned to that device and click history.

Or, go to the gear, advanced, devices and select the device you want to view current states and history for.

This can be done via dashboards that are local or cloud based.

I was having problem with sensors far away from hub (60'), even I have few plugs in between (supposed to be repeater). What I did was adjust the hub location, power off 30 minutes, let it rebuild the zigbee mesh network. After that, no more unstable devices.
I did not recall I had this kind problem with Iris hub, may be I had devices add up few at a time back then.

I found an interesting bug on door sensor, when temperature below 32 F, it show 740x. It was a cold night here. I put one sensor in my freezer, it is now 7384 F ( should be around 10 F). May be a format conversion error when in below 0 range ( C).
